Directorate Change

22nd Mar 2005 07:00

First Artist Corporation PLC22 March 2005 22 March 2005 First Artist Corporation plc ("First Artist" or the "Company") Appointment of Non-Executive Chairman The Board of First Artist is pleased to announce the appointment of Timothy JohnMackenzie Chadwick as non-executive Chairman effective from Monday 21 March 2005.He takes over from Alex Johnston who has resigned as Chairman. Tim, aged 58, is currently Chairman of Simon Group plc. No further informationneeds to be disclosed under the AIM Rules. Tim previously founded Aurum Press Ltd., a successful publishing company, whichhe sold to Andrew Lloyd Webber's Really Useful Company in 1992. He then boughtback the children's publishing arm in 1992, which traded as All Books forChildren ("ABC") Ltd. ABC was then sold to HIT Entertainment plc in 1995. Timalso floated Benicia Ports plc, later renamed American Port Services plc, on theLondon Stock Exchange in 1994, which was then acquired by Associated BritishPorts plc in 1999. Jon Smith, Chief Executive of First Artist said: "We are delighted to welcomeTim to the Board. Given his track record and experience, Tim will play a majorrole in the development of First Artist as we develop into a broadly basedpersonality and sports marketing event management business and he will beintegral to our planned acquisition programme." "On behalf of the Board I would also like to thank Alex Johnston for all hissupport and advice. He has been invaluable to the development of the Company andhis significant contribution has enabled First Artist to reach its currentpositive position. Alex will now be able to concentrate his time on otherbusiness interests and we wish him well for the future."
